        	        	<description><![CDATA[<p>Yes, and unlocked phone will work for use in the USA. Keep in mind that the phone must use the North American 850/1900 GSM bands. As far as I know all of the phones currently sold by SpeakOut in Canada are locked, so your best bet would be to find an unlocked phone elsewhere, or get a prepaid phone package while in the USA.</p>

        	        	<description><![CDATA[<p>jbond,</p>
<p>No where on the official SpeakOut site does it say you can use your phone in the USA. Here's a couple of copy and pastes from the official site:</p>
<p>"Can I use my SpeakOut phone anywhere in the world?</p>
<p>Calls can be made from within Canada to anywhere in the world. Long distance rates apply (plus per minute airtime rates). See the Long Distance Chart for more information.</p>
<p>You cannot make calls from within the U.S. or from elsewhere outside of Canada as SpeakOut in Canada does not provide roaming services."</p>
<p>Read especially the second statement where it clearly says you can not use the phone outside of Canada. SpeakOut in Canada does NOT provide roaming.</p>
<p>One more copy and paste, similar to yours:</p>
<p>"Text Messaging<br />
Outgoing Text Messages:<br />
10c to Canadian Wireless Numbers<br />
10c to US Wireless Numbers<br />
25c to International Wireless Numbers"</p>
<p>All those rates are outgoing, while your phone is in Canada. The Canadian SpeakOut service only works in Canada.</p>

        	        	<description><![CDATA[<p>Were you trying to use your Canada SO phone/SIM in the States?  SO USA and SO Can are 2 totally separate companies and a SO Can phone/SIM won't work in the US.  I'm guessing those rates/etc are for people on USA SO.</p>
